Output 34170afb6dbe51846da359bd399cb41c6a566b2faed70340aae5397b7a3a655f:1

value
435648750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e82c3997e0c7bb580b2cbbc3622cd09aee07a65b OP_EQUAL
address
3NrdfrTH4ZrQR3exrvpy5ocqnWfVm6fdvw
transaction
34170afb6dbe51846da359bd399cb41c6a566b2faed70340aae5397b7a3a655f